Originally Posted by bnet504
how exactly did they make the axim recognize the hard drive?
Microdrives, like the 5GB one from the Rio, are housed in CF Type II casings, so you just throw them in your CF slot and they show up like any other flash card.

For external USB drives like Lucidnight talks about, the USB host card from Ratoc comes with a mass storage driver that you install on the PPC. It will allow the PPC to talk to most portable hard drives that obey the mass storage spec - like iPods, Archos drives and jukeboxes, etc.

the 20gb is NOT a microdrive in the cf form factor

the biggest microdrive available right nowis the seagate 5gb found in rio carbons
im running one in my x50 right now
